Patsy Sebastian Pizzuto Memorial, (sculpture).
Artist:
Unknown, sculptor.
Title:
Patsy Sebastian Pizzuto Memorial, (sculpture).
Dates:
ca. 1995.
Medium:
Sculpture: granite and polished black granite.
Dimensions:
Sculpture: approx. 5 x 3 x 3 ft.
Inscription:
(On front:) "Patsy" Sebastian Pizzuto/Born April 11, 1924/Died May 17, 1995/Life long resident of Mt. Auburn/Veteran of World War II/1944-1946/American Division/Commander of/Mt. Auburn VFW/Post 8818 for 17 Terms/Unwavering in His Dedication/to His Community/and His Country/Deeply Devoted to His/Family, Friends and His Faith (On back:) SUCCESS/To laugh often and much;/to win the respect of intelligent/people and affection of/children;/to earn the appreciation of honest/critics and endure the betrayal of false friends;/to appreciated beauty, to find the/best in others;/to leave the world a bit better/whether by a healthy child, a/garden patch or a redeemed social/condition; to know even one life has breathed/easier because you lived/This is to have succeeded./Ralph Waldo Emerson unsigned
Description:
A rectangular grey granite marker with an arched top is adorned on the front with a portrait of Patsy Sebastian Pizzuto etched on a circle of black granite. On the back of the marker is the insignia of the Veterans of Foreign Wars of the United States and a poem entitled "Success" by Ralph Waldo Emerson.
